This isn’t your everyday two-bedroom condo. You’ll find this gorgeous midtown Toronto home for rent inside a converted church known as St. George on Sheldrake.

From the outside, you’d never know that this breathtaking structure was home to luxurious and modern apartments.

This unbelievable gem features 10-foot coffered ceilings and a 400-square-foot south-facing outdoor terrace surrounded by lush greenery and the privacy of tall trees.
